Professional Background

Justine Grieve is an accomplished professional leveraging her extensive experience in environmental, social, and governance (ESG) issues alongside a robust background in risk management, insurance, and climate change. Throughout her career, Justine has consistently demonstrated her ability to engage with board members and senior executives, providing them with comprehensive risk solutions tailored to today’s dynamic business environment. With a proven track record in developing effective decision-making frameworks, she has successfully tackled complex challenges, driving meaningful business outcomes that align with sustainability principles.

Justine's career began in journalism at City Hub newspaper, where she honed her skills in communication and storytelling, essential skills that would later serve her well in the world of corporate governance and risk management. Over the years, she transitioned into more strategic roles within renowned organizations, most notably Origin Energy, where she has held various significant positions including Senior Insurance Manager, demonstrating her adeptness at managing substantial budgets and leading pivotal projects.

One of Justine's remarkable achievements includes her role in structuring captives and operationalizing enterprise-wide management of change strategies, a skill she effectively utilizies to spot growth opportunities across diverse business sectors. Her pragmatic and innovative approach to driving sustainability initiatives marks her as a forward-thinker in her field. Moreover, her ability to manage considerable budgets exceeding $100 million exemplifies her strong financial acumen and trustworthiness in high-stakes environments.

A lifelong learner, Justine is deeply passionate about acquiring knowledge that enhances her skills portfolio, which allows her to add value to stakeholders effectively. Her commitment to personal and professional development is evidenced by her acceptance into the prestigious ‘CleanTech Women’ fellowship, where she further expanded her expertise in Minimum Viable Products (MVPs), design thinking, and business strategy.

Education and Achievements

Justine's academic journey is just as impressive as her professional experiences, reflecting her commitment to educational excellence. She studied at top institutions where she consistently achieved high distinctions and accolades, earning her credibility and expertise in her fields of study. This includes a Master of Laws in Enterprise Governance from Bond University, where she participated in the 'Get Board Ready' program, emphasizing her dedication to aligning her legal knowledge with corporate governance.

In addition to her legal education, Justine completed a Master of Health Administration at the University of New South Wales, which she accomplished with Distinction. Here, she broadened her understanding of management in healthcare, equipping her with unique insights into governance issues affecting the sector. Complementing her qualifications, Justine also pursued studies in Neuro Linguistic Programming (NLP) at the University of Sydney and Total Quality Management at AGSM @ UNSW Business School, highlighting her interest in innovative management practices and leadership strategies.

Her qualifications do not end there; she also acquired training in Private Investigation, showcasing her diverse interests and abilities to analyze situations comprehensively. Justine began her formal education with a Bachelor’s Degree in Journalism from the University of Technology Sydney, where her passion for communication first ignited, setting a strong foundation for her later career.

Justine was recognized as a university prize winner during her studies, further validating her commitment to excellence and achievement.
